Colony Spring Gardens

Colony Spring Gardens is Colony's first venue in Manchester's Central Business District, set across newly refurbished floors at 19 Spring Gardens in the heart of the city. Members enjoy premium meeting rooms, spacious breakout areas and a balcony terrace, with a huge choice of workspaces including some of Colony's largest private offices. It is an ideal base for freelancers, remote workers and businesses of every size, from start ups to established brands. The Market Street Metrolink stop is about three minutes away.

Frequently asked questions about Colony Spring Gardens

The address is 19 Spring Gardens, Manchester, M2 1FB.

Reception is staffed Monday to Friday, 9:00am to 5:30pm. Members have 24/7 access.

Private offices range from small offices for 4 people up to large suites for 40 or more people, alongside dedicated desks.

Facilities include ultra-fast Wi-Fi, four meeting rooms, a balcony terrace, a social kitchen, spacious breakout areas, personal storage and secure bike storage.

Colony Spring Gardens is at 19 Spring Gardens in the heart of the city centre. The Market Street Metrolink stop is about three minutes away and Manchester Piccadilly station is a fifteen minute walk.

How to get there?

Colony Spring Gardens is right in the middle of Manchester city centre, a stone's throw from Market Street, with shopping, bars and restaurants all minutes away. The Northern Quarter and Spinningfields are around the corner, and the Market Street Metrolink stop is about three minutes from the front door. Manchester Piccadilly station is roughly a fifteen minute walk.
